Property Description for 251-253 West 70th Street, 1

The "Queen Anne Sisters" as the buildings are known at 251-255 West 70th Street -were designed by reknowned architect of his day, W. H. W. Youngs, in the Queen Anne style and was built in 1885 . Apartment #1 is part of the coop that is now referred to as 251-253 West 70th Street.

This upper west side garden apartment really does have it ALL. It's newly renovated, has a chef's kitchen with storage pantry, stainless steel top of the line appliances including gas oven and stove top as well as a dishwasher. There's a custom tiled marble bathroom with large spa-sized shower and side-by-side sinks, large bedroom with a gas fireplace and double french doors leading out onto your very own private spacious planted backyard garden. As if all that isn't enough -down your own interior staircase is where you find the huge private bonus rooom/multi-purpose room/dry cellar -that can be used for all sorts of storage and also houses the side by side washing machine and dryer.

Located nearby are Trader Joe's, Citarella, Zabars and Whole Foods grocery stores -to name a few. Cafe Luxembourg and Rosa Mexicano are just two of the many neighborhood restaurant favorites.

The Red Line Express and Local Subway (1,2 & 3) is practically around the corner.

Quick Profile

Centered, in name and location, around the Lincoln Center for the Performing Arts, Lincoln Square’s history is heavily steeped in strong African American and Afro-Caribbean roots. Iconic jazz pianist, Thelonious Monk, is counted among its many former artistic and professional denizens.

The neighborhood is beloved for its amazing shopping, its distinguished art scene, and phenomenal restaurants--and don’t forget Central Park. From Lincoln Square, one is at the gateway to virtually everything New York City has to offer, either in your backyard or via excellent subway access.

With its beautiful pre-war architecture surrounded by some of NYC’s premier skyscrapers, Lincoln Square has become a safe, much sought after neighborhood. If you like living in the action, there are few places in the world that can rival Lincoln Square.
